Hoof & Paw Animal Rescue & Thrift Store
Hoof & Paw Animal Rescue & Thrift Store in Naturita, Colorado serves a dual purpose that makes it truly special in this close-knit Western Slope community. Every purchase you make at this 321 E Main St location directly supports their animal rescue mission, helping abandoned and neglected animals find care, shelter, and loving homes. The store offers a constantly rotating selection of secondhand treasures while fostering a compassionate community dedicated to animal welfare. Shopping here means you're not just finding great deals – you're making a direct impact on the lives of animals in need throughout Montrose County and beyond. The volunteers and staff are passionate about both their rescue work and helping shoppers discover unexpected finds, creating a warm, welcoming atmosphere that keeps locals coming back week after week.

What They Sell
Hoof & Paw Animal Rescue & Thrift Store offers a diverse selection of donated goods typical of community thrift stores, including gently used clothing for all ages, household items, kitchenware, books, small furniture pieces, and decorative items. Since inventory depends entirely on community donations, each visit brings new surprises and unique finds. You'll often discover items with that vintage Colorado character alongside everyday essentials. The constantly changing stock means dedicated thrifters can always find something different, and all proceeds benefit the animals in their rescue program.
